Homes listed or recently sold were built 1995–1999; none of the 3 geocoded homes sit in a FEMA special flood hazard zone (median elevation 21 ft). Silverado Subdivision is a community in Rockledge, Brevard County, FL.

Silverado is a small, finished subdivision in Rockledge - 40 homes built in a tight window from 1995 to 2001, with a median build year of 1999. That uniformity matters: nobody here is competing against brand-new construction inside the community, and the median living area of about 2,137 square feet tells you this is a mid-size, single-family product rather than a mix of footprints. With that little variation in age and size, what actually moves price is condition and updates. A kitchen and bath that have been carried forward will separate one house from the next far more than square footage will.
Right now there are zero active listings, and a homestead share near 73% points to an owner-occupied, low-turnover pocket. For a seller, that scarcity is leverage - there is no competing inventory inside the subdivision to anchor a buyer's expectations. For a buyer, it means patience: you may wait for a home to come to market rather than choose from several. When one does list, be ready to move and to underwrite the condition carefully, because there won't be a second comparable sitting next door.

A closed pocket where condition is the whole game
With homes clustered around a 1999 build and a median of roughly 2,137 square feet, Silverado reads as a consistent, mature subdivision. There are no community amenities identified in the current MLS data, so you're buying the house and the location, not a shared clubhouse or pool. That keeps carrying costs simpler, but it also means the value proposition rests almost entirely on the individual home - its roof, systems, and interior updates over the past two-plus decades.
The homestead share sitting near 73% signals a stable, owner-held community with limited churn. Combined with no active listings as of mid-2026, expect thin supply. That's a double-edged setup: sellers benefit from scarcity, but buyers should treat any listing as a rare window and be prepared to evaluate deferred maintenance quickly, since there is no in-subdivision inventory to compare against.
